Important Tips for Buying Fences for Your Home or Business

Buying fences or even one is not something you should ever take lightly because making the wrong decision will be painful. You need to have some guidelines to follow so you can make the best decision, and of course price is a factor and you need to stay in your budget. It's tougher than you think to really know what the finished project will be, so you have to know what you want. So now you have a better appreciation for what's involved with purchasing your new fence, and here are some tips to assist you.

Unless your home is located in a rural area, don't forget about those who are around you before installing any fence. This of course means your neighbors, and you may have to pay attention to your local laws about zoning, but you would think that you could put up a fence on your garden if you want. This is really easy to check on, and you can even find out probably online regarding zoning requirements and permits for this and that. The thing about this is you are unfortunately not able to put something you want on your property because you want it - you need various permissions sometimes.
